Technical Instructions. 9.1. The goods shall be used in accordance with the technical instructions (i.e. user information, blueprints, etc.) of the Seller or shall otherwise be excluded from warranty and compensation claims. 9.2. The Seller shall deliver digital versions of the manufacturer’s instructions for the sold goods. It is the Customer’s responsibility to obtain at its own cost the technical instructions of the Seller in other formats or additional instructions necessary for the abovementioned purposes. 9.3. Technical advice from the employees of the Seller is restricted to an explanation of the written instructions of the Seller; the Seller shall not be liable for information from his employees over and above this. Only the Technical Office of the Seller is authorized to give information beyond an explanation of the written instructions of the Seller, in particular appropriate solutions for specific applications. The Customer shall only obtain such information from the Technical Office.
